Query 5: What’s the distinction between “half-staff” and “half-mast?”
Whereas typically used interchangeably, “half-staff” usually refers to flag shows on land, whereas “half-mast” is historically utilized in a naval context. The sensible that means is similar: the flag is lowered to roughly midway between the highest and backside of the flagpole.
